Been meaning to do this for a while.
The starting xi that last got us promoted, games played that season, games played the next season, outcome
Garner, 49, 48, released to a league 2 team
Lockwood, 47, 46, sold to a league 1 team
Mackie, 46, 36, released to league 2 team
Zakuani, 50, 0, sold after promotion to prem team
Miller, 41, 31, released to a league one team
Keith, 46, 8, released to a league 2 team
Easton, 42, 33, joined another league 1 team
Simpson, 51, 16, released to a league 2 team
Tudor, 35, 31, released to a league 1 team
Alexander, 49, 45, joined another league 1 team
Ibehre, 27, 16, stayed a further season then joined a league one team

So just one season after being promoted jabo was the only player from the main xi still at three club! With the vast majority of the team being released to weaker teams.

Goes to show the step up between leagues, and why expectations are far too high for the current crop of players.
